Student Population at SRMC Professional Schools
Total Enrollment
151 (all undergraduate)
Undergraduate
151
Men Students
14
Women Students
137
For the academic year 2024-2025, a total of 151 students have enrolled at Southside College of Health Sciences (all undergraduate).
By gender, 14 male and 137 female students are attending Southside College of Health Sciences. By attendance status, there are 10 full-time students and 141 part-time students.
The number of students at Southside College of Health Sciences is large compared to Private (not-for-profit), 2-4 Years Colleges in Virginia. Compared to similar schools in rankings such as Sovah School of Health Professions and Fortis College-Norfolk, its population is very small (average population is 304).

Enrollment by Gender/Attending Status
By gender, there are 14 male and 137 female students attending SRMC Professional Schools. The male-to-female student ratio is 0.10 to 1 and the ratio is than national average (the national average is 0.75 to 1).
The following table and chart show the student population by gender and attending status at SRMC Professional Schools.
| Total | Full-time | Part-time |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total | 151 | 10 | 141 |
| Men | 14 | 1 | 13 |
| Women | 137 | 9 | 128 |
Enrollment by Race/Ethnicity
By race/ethnicity, there are 94 White students (62.25%) and 38 Black or African American students (25.17%) at Southside College of Health Sciences(top 2 most races/ethnicities). The following table summarizes the population diversity by race at Southside College of Health Sciences.
| Total | Men | Women | |
|---|---|---|---|
| American Indian or Alaska Native | 3 | 0 | 3 |
| Asian | 6 | 0 | 6 |
| Black or African American | 38 | 3 | 35 |
| Hispanic | 3 | 0 | 3 |
|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ander | 1 | 0 | 1 |
| White | 94 | 10 | 84 |
| Two or More Races | 4 | 1 | 3 |
| Race/Ethnicity Unknown | 2 | 0 | 2 |
| Total | 151 | 14 | 137 |
Enrollment by Student Age
By age, there are 64 students whose age under twenty five and 52 students whose age is over thirty years old at Southside College of Health Sciences.
The following table and chart show the student population by student age at Southside College of Health Sciences.
| Total | Men | Women |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total | 151 | 14 | 137 |
| 18-19 | 5 | 1 | 4 |
| 20-21 | 22 | 0 | 22 |
| 22-24 | 37 | 3 | 34 |
| 25-29 | 35 | 5 | 30 |
| 30-34 | 19 | 1 | 18 |
| 35-39 | 10 | 1 | 9 |
| 40-49 | 21 | 3 | 18 |
| 50-64 | 2 | 0 | 2 |
| Total | 151 | 14 | 137 |
